Can Swimming pools, saunas etc ruin my hairpiece? |
|
|
|
Shampoo out the chlorine as soon as you can after contacting such water. Yes it will be bad for the hairpiece hair and also your own real hair, but if you love swimming etc. then enjoy the water and expect a shorter lifespan for the hairpiece. Don't worry about it too much.
Sauna heat is not hot enough to damage hair, but if you have synthetic hair or a lot of gray, avoid the initial heat blast when the rocks are splashed as that could be hot enough to damage synthetic. It won't harm the base. Adhesion will be compromised.
